On November 5th, 2019, we collected approximately 2,200 exit polls from voters at 28 sites in Charleston and Berkeley counties.

Our students are in school today, conducting our annual exit polling exercise at 28 polling locations across the Lowcountry. They also hosted and interviewed many of the candidates in today’s races and learned about the history of voting rights in America. This is part of our program to develop citizens who will think for themselves, do their own research about the issues of the day, and will actively uplift their communities.
